Choosing the Right Equipment
1. Skates
Investing in a good pair of rollerblades is essential for a comfortable and enjoyable skating experience. Consider factors such as boot type, wheel size, and closure system when choosing your skates.
2. Protective Gear
Safety should always be a priority when rollerblading. Make sure to wear a helmet, knee pads, elbow pads, and wrist guards to protect yourself from potential injuries.
Mastering Basic Techniques
1. Balancing
Start by practicing your balance on a flat and smooth surface. Keep your knees slightly bent and your weight centered over your skates. Use your arms for stability and maintain a relaxed posture.
2. Forward Skating
To move forward, push off with one foot while keeping the other foot gliding smoothly on the ground. Alternate pushing with each foot to maintain a steady rhythm.
Advanced Techniques
1. Turning
Mastering turns is crucial for navigating corners and obstacles. Practice leaning your body in the direction you want to turn and using your edges to initiate the turn.
2. Jumping
Once you’ve built confidence in your skating abilities, you can start learning jumps. Start with small jumps and gradually increase the height and complexity of your jumps as you progress.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. How long does it take to learn rollerblading?
The time it takes to learn rollerblading varies from person to person. With regular practice and dedication, most beginners can become comfortable on skates within a few weeks.
2. Can rollerblading help with fitness?
Absolutely! Rollerblading is a great cardiovascular exercise that engages multiple muscle groups. It can help improve balance, coordination, and overall fitness levels.
